Understanding Compressive Strength

Compressive strength is a fundamental mechanical property that measures a material's ability to withstand a compressive load without failure. When a material is subjected to a compressive force, it experiences a reduction in volume. The compressive strength is defined as the maximum compressive stress that a material can endure before it fractures or deforms permanently.

For nano alumina, the compressive strength is a crucial parameter as it determines its performance in applications where it is exposed to high - pressure environments. Whether it is used in structural components, abrasive materials, or as a filler in composites, the ability of nano alumina to resist compression is essential for ensuring the reliability and durability of the final product.

Factors Affecting the Compressive Strength of Nano Alumina

Particle Size

One of the most significant factors influencing the compressive strength of nano alumina is its particle size. Nano - sized alumina particles have a much larger surface - to - volume ratio compared to their micro - sized counterparts. This high surface - to - volume ratio leads to stronger inter - particle bonding, which in turn enhances the compressive strength of the material.

As the particle size decreases, the number of grain boundaries increases. Grain boundaries act as barriers to the movement of dislocations, which are defects in the crystal structure of the material. By impeding the movement of dislocations, the material becomes more resistant to deformation under compression, resulting in higher compressive strength.

Purity

The purity of nano alumina also plays a vital role in determining its compressive strength. Impurities in the alumina can act as weak points in the material, reducing its overall strength. High - purity nano alumina, with a low content of impurities such as silica, iron, and titanium, has a more uniform crystal structure and fewer defects. This uniformity allows the material to distribute the compressive load more evenly, leading to higher compressive strength.

Sintering Process

The sintering process is a critical step in the production of nano alumina components. Sintering involves heating the alumina powder to a high temperature to promote particle bonding and densification. The sintering temperature, time, and atmosphere can significantly affect the compressive strength of the final product.

A well - controlled sintering process can result in a dense and homogeneous microstructure, which is essential for high compressive strength. If the sintering temperature is too low, the particles may not bond effectively, leading to a porous structure with low strength. On the other hand, if the temperature is too high, the material may experience grain growth, which can also reduce the compressive strength.

Compressive Strength of Nano Alumina in Different Applications

Structural Ceramics

In structural ceramics, nano alumina is used to manufacture components that require high strength and wear resistance. For example, in the aerospace industry, nano alumina is used in the production of turbine blades and engine components. These components are subjected to high temperatures and pressures during operation, and the high compressive strength of nano alumina ensures their reliability and performance.

The compressive strength of nano alumina in structural ceramics can range from several hundred megapascals to over a gigapascal, depending on the specific composition and processing conditions. This high strength allows the components to withstand the extreme forces encountered in aerospace applications.

Abrasive Materials

Nano alumina is also widely used in abrasive materials, such as grinding wheels and sandpapers. In these applications, the compressive strength of nano alumina is crucial for maintaining the shape and integrity of the abrasive particles during the grinding process.

The high compressive strength of nano alumina enables it to resist the forces exerted during grinding, preventing the particles from breaking or deforming. This results in a more efficient and longer - lasting abrasive material, which can improve the quality and productivity of the grinding process.

Composites

As a filler in composites, nano alumina can enhance the mechanical properties of the matrix material. When added to polymers or metals, nano alumina can increase the compressive strength of the composite by providing reinforcement.

The distribution of nano alumina particles in the matrix and the interface between the particles and the matrix are important factors in determining the effectiveness of the reinforcement. A well - dispersed nano alumina filler can significantly improve the compressive strength of the composite, making it suitable for applications such as automotive parts and construction materials.
